Historic museums within reach
Nearby, history awaits. The Museum of Egyptian Civilization is only five kilometers from the hotel, and the Coptic Museum, home to treasured religious artifacts, is six kilometers away.
For those wanting to dive deeper into Egypt’s past, the Grand Egyptian Museum, one of the world’s largest archaeological museums, is about 19 kilometers from the hotel.
If modern city life is more your pace, Cairo Festival City is around 23 kilometers away, offering a mix of shopping, dining, and entertainment that complements the city’s historic charm.

Convenient access to airports; signature dining with Nile views
While Hilton Cairo Nile Maadi does not have a direct airport shuttle, it’s well-connected to Cairo’s two main airports.
Cairo International Airport, the city’s primary international gateway, is about 23 kilometers away, providing convenient access for travelers.
Sphinx International Airport, 48 kilometers from the hotel, serves western Cairo and is a gateway to the historic sites near Giza.

Food lovers will appreciate O’Nile, the hotel’s signature restaurant, which offers refined international cuisine alongside interactive cooking stations, all with a view of the Nile.
Nearby, Dayma serves regional dishes and traditional shisha on a relaxing terrace designed for socializing. For a laid-back vibe, the Tonic Pool Bar offers light snacks and handcrafted cocktails beside the water.
Luxury wellness with Egyptian roots
The hotel’s wellness offerings add another layer to the stay. The full-service spa combines ancient Egyptian healing methods with modern treatments.
Signature options include the cupping Healing Massage, which helps improve circulation and ease stress, and the Nile Sand Massage, which uses heated sand and water pillows to soothe tired muscles. These treatments show the hotel’s focus on helping guests unwind and feel refreshed.
